Summary: | ASTERISK-14726: failure to to jump to fax extension on fax tone detect | ||
Reporter: | Vlad M (vlad) | Labels: | |
Date Opened: | 2009-12-20 07:22:48.000-0600 | Date Closed: | 2009-12-22 15:26:47.000-0600 |
Priority: | Major | Regression? | No |
Status: | Closed/Complete | Components: | PBX/General |
Versions: | Frequency of Occurrence | ||
Related Issues: | |||
Environment: | Attachments: | ||
Description: | sip channel is configured with faxdetect=yes 'fax' extension defined in default context when asterisk senses fax tone and tries to jump to fax extension, it fails with this record: -- Executing [15555555774@default:5] BackGround("SIP/sipprovider-00000002", "vm-nobodyavail") in new stack -- <SIP/sipprovider-00000002> Playing 'vm-nobodyavail.ulaw' (language 'en') [Dec 20 07:17:11] NOTICE[3683]: rtp.c:1790 ast_rtp_read: Unknown RTP codec 100 received from 'SOME.IP.ADDRE.SS' == Redirecting 'SIP/sipprovider-00000002' to fax extension -- Sent into invalid extension 'ΓΏ' in context 'default' on SIP/sipprovider-00000002 -- Executing [i@default:1] Playback("SIP/sipprovider-00000002", "pbx-invalid") in new stack -- <SIP/sipprovider-00000002> Playing 'pbx-invalid.ulaw' (language 'en') ****** ADDITIONAL INFORMATION ****** [default] ..... exten => fax,1,Set(FAXFILE=/var/spool/asterisk/fax/${UNIQUEID}) exten => fax,n,ReceiveFAX(${FAXFILE}.tif) exten => fax,n,Set(CALLERIDNAME=${CALLERID(name)}) exten => fax,n,Set(CALLERIDNUM=${CALLERID(number)}) exten => fax,n,system(/usr/local/bin/fax2mail -p -f "${FAXFILE}" --cid-name "${CALLERIDNAME}" --cid-number "${CALLERIDNUM}" --dest-name SOMENAME --dest-email some@address.net) exten => fax,n,Hangup | ||
Comments: | By: Vlad M (vlad) 2009-12-20 08:39:08.000-0600 re-compiled with DONT_OPTIMIZE - same thing By: Leif Madsen (lmadsen) 2009-12-22 15:26:47.000-0600 Duplicate of ASTERISK-14968. |